用于网络设备集群管理的方法、装置及处理器与流程

文档序号:37488506发布日期:2024-04-01 13:57阅读:10来源:国知局
用于网络设备集群管理的方法、装置及处理器与流程

本申请涉及网络设备管理,具体地涉及一种用于网络设备集群管理的方法、装置及处理器。


背景技术:

1、随着企业规模的扩展,分支机构越来越多,针对企业网络的管理系统,所管理的网络设备越来越多。在面临设备大规模上线、或集中管理平台重启后,设备上线的时间将直接影响网络业务的管理及用户体验。现有技术中,在进行小规模(小于100台)设备管理时,设备上线时间较短,管理平台可以通过轮询的方式探测设备状态。但随着设备管理规模的越来越大,当超过几千甚至几万的设备集中上线时,在管理平台上,设备将无法快速变更为在线状态。因此,现有技术存在大规模数量设备集中上线时间较长的问题。


技术实现思路

1、本申请实施例的目的是提供一种用于网络设备集群管理的方法、装置及处理器,用以解决现有技术中大规模数量设备集中上线时间较长的问题。

2、为了实现上述目的,本申请实施例第一方面提供一种用于网络设备集群管理的方法,网络设备集群包括多个网络设备,方法包括:

3、根据预设的轮询周期对多个网络设备的状态进行轮询,以得到多个网络设备的状态信息;

4、将多个网络设备的状态信息更新至设备状态数据库中;

5、在需要对多个网络设备进行状态恢复的情况下,从设备状态信息数据库中获取已存储的多个网络设备对应的历史状态信息;

6、根据历史状态信息对多个网络设备的状态进行恢复。

7、在本申请实施例中,方法还包括:判断多个网络设备的状态信息是否更新完成;在判定更新完成的情况下,等待下一个轮询周期以更新多个网络设备的状态信息;在判定更新未完成的情况下,对多个网络设备的状态进行轮询,以得到多个设备的状态信息。

8、在本申请实施例中,方法还包括:在接收到操作请求的情况下,获取多个网络设备中,与操作请求对应的目标网络设备的状态信息的更新时间;判断更新时间是否处于预设时间范围内;在判定更新时间处于预设时间范围内的情况下,对目标网络设备执行操作请求。

9、在本申请实施例中,方法还包括:在判定更新时间不处于预设时间范围内的情况下,获取目标网络设备的实时状态信息;根据目标网络设备的实时状态信息对目标网络设备进行对应的管理操作。

10、在本申请实施例中,根据目标网络设备的实时状态信息对目标网络设备进行对应的管理操作包括:判断目标网络设备的实时状态信息是否为在线状态;在判定目标网络设备的实时状态信息为在线状态的情况下,对目标网络设备执行操作请求;在判定目标网络设备的实时状态信息为不在线状态的情况下,结束操作请求。

11、在本申请实施例中,多个网络设备的状态信息存储于设备状态数据库中对应的设备状态表中,设备状态表包括:设备id、设备名称、设备状态以及状态更新时间。

12、本申请实施例第二方面提供一种用于网络设备集群管理的装置,装置包括:轮询模块,用于根据预设的轮询周期对多个网络设备的状态进行轮询,以得到多个网络设备的状态信息;更新模块,用于将多个网络设备的状态信息更新至设备状态数据库中;获取模块,用于在需要对多个网络设备进行状态恢复的情况下,从设备状态信息数据库中获取已存储的多个网络设备对应的历史状态信息;恢复模块,用于根据历史状态信息对多个网络设备的状态进行恢复。

13、本申请实施例第三方面提供一种处理器,被配置成执行根据上述的用于网络设备集群管理的方法。

14、本申请实施例第四方面提供一种计算机设备,包括:存储器;以及根据上述的处理器。

15、本申请实施例第五方面提供一种机器可读存储介质,该机器可读存储介质上存储有指令,该指令用于使得机器执行根据上述的用于网络设备集群管理的方法。

16、通过上述技术方案,根据预设的轮询周期对多个网络设备的状态进行轮询,以得到多个网络设备的状态信息,然后将多个网络设备的状态信息更新至设备状态数据库中,在需要对多个网络设备进行状态恢复的情况下,从设备状态信息数据库中获取已存储的多个网络设备对应的历史状态信息,最后根据历史状态信息对多个网络设备的状态进行恢复。本申请能有效缩短设备全部下线后重新上线的时间,避免了由于重新上线周期长导致的无法及时对现网业务进行管理维护的问题。

17、本申请实施例的其它特征和优点将在随后的具体实施方式部分予以详细说明。



技术特征:

1.一种用于网络设备集群管理的方法,其特征在于,所述网络设备集群包括多个网络设备,所述方法包括:

2.根据权利要求1所述的方法,其特征在于,所述方法还包括:

3.根据权利要求1所述的方法,其特征在于,所述方法还包括:

4.根据权利要求3所述的方法,其特征在于,所述方法还包括:

5.根据权利要求4所述的方法,其特征在于,所述根据所述目标网络设备的实时状态信息对所述目标网络设备进行对应的管理操作包括:

6.根据权利要求1所述的方法,其特征在于,所述多个网络设备的状态信息存储于所述设备状态数据库中对应的设备状态表中,所述设备状态表包括:

7.一种用于网络设备集群管理的装置,其特征在于,所述装置包括:

8.一种处理器,其特征在于,被配置成执行根据权利要求1至6中任一项所述的用于网络设备集群管理的方法。

9.一种计算机设备,其特征在于,包括:

10.一种机器可读存储介质,其特征在于,该机器可读存储介质上存储有指令,该指令用于使得机器执行根据权利要求1至6中任一项所述的用于网络设备集群管理的方法。


技术总结
本申请公开了一种用于网络设备集群管理的方法、装置及处理器,属于网络设备管理技术领域。该方法包括:根据预设的轮询周期对多个网络设备的状态进行轮询,以得到多个网络设备的状态信息;将多个网络设备的状态信息更新至设备状态数据库中;在需要对多个网络设备进行状态恢复的情况下,从设备状态信息数据库中获取已存储的多个网络设备对应的历史状态信息;根据历史状态信息对多个网络设备的状态进行恢复。本申请能有效缩短设备全部下线后重新上线的时间,避免了由于重新上线周期长导致的无法及时对现网业务进行管理维护的问题。

技术研发人员:田静伟,于星杰
受保护的技术使用者:北京天融信网络安全技术有限公司
技术研发日:
技术公布日:2024/3/31
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1